Welcome Offers: Matching Deposits, Free Spins, and No-Wager Deals
To genuinely boost your bankroll, prioritize reload bonuses and cashback offers over high-wagering welcome packages. Low-wagering casino bonuses are the most effective tool, as they require a rollover of 20x or less, converting bonus funds into withdrawable cash with minimal risk. Look for weekly loyalty drops and no-requirement free spins, which add direct value without trapping your winnings in playthrough conditions.
Compare offers by their effective value—consider the maximum bet allowed and game contribution percentages. A 100% match up to $200 with 25x wagering outperforms a 200% match up to $100 with 40x. Always read the terms for excluded games and time limits, as these silently erode real profit.
- Cashback (5–15%) on net losses: returns a portion of your stake weekly.
- High-roller deposit bonuses: paired with reduced wagering, ideal for larger sessions.
Q: Are no-wagering bonuses rare? A: Yes, they are limited to 1–5% of offers, but they provide 100% clear value—always prioritize them.

Responsible Gambling Tools and Player Protection
Responsible gambling tools are integral to modern player protection frameworks, encompassing self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and reality checks that empower users to manage their behavior. These mechanisms are designed to mitigate harm by promoting transparency and control, with operators required to display clear access to support services. Effective implementation relies on data-driven algorithms that detect risky patterns, such as erratic betting intervals or escalating losses, triggering automated interventions like cooling-off periods. Regulatory bodies mandate these features, ensuring that platforms balance commercial interests with duty-of-care obligations. Continuous refinement of such tools, including personalized feedback and educational resources, helps foster a safer environment. However, effectiveness depends on user uptake and seamless integration into the gaming interface, reducing friction while maximizing awareness.
Q: What is the primary purpose of self-exclusion tools?
A: They allow players to voluntarily block access to gaming platforms for a set duration, serving as a crucial barrier against compulsive play.

Reality Checks and Activity Tracking Dashboards
Responsible gambling tools are designed to empower players to maintain control over their betting activities. Core features typically include deposit limits, loss limits, wager limits, session time reminders, and self-exclusion options that can be temporary or permanent. These mechanisms enable users to set personal boundaries before gambling begins, preventing impulsive decisions during gameplay. Many regulated operators also offer reality checks that pop up periodically to display time spent and net losses. The most effective player protection frameworks combine these digital safeguards with access to account statements and https://20freespinsonregistrationnodeposit.co.uk/ cooling-off periods. Furthermore, robust platforms integrate affordability checks and link directly to support services for problem gambling, ensuring a layered approach to harm minimization. Such provisions are not merely compliance requirements but are essential for fostering a sustainable and ethical gambling environment.
